Global 3D Printing Industrial Landscape

The global 3D printing industry, also known as additive manufacturing, has transitioned from a prototyping tool to a robust industrial production powerhouse. In 2024, the market is witnessing an unprecedented surge as companies worldwide integrate 3D printers into their core supply chains. From aerospace components to personalized medical implants, 3D printing technology is redefining what is possible in modern engineering.

Key Trends Shaping the Future of 3D Printing

Sustainability & Circular Economy: Modern 3D printers are now capable of utilizing recycled filaments and powders, drastically reducing carbon footprints in manufacturing hubs.

The industry is moving toward high-speed production. New technologies such as High-Speed Sintering (HSS) and advanced FDM (Fused Deposition Modeling) systems are allowing factories to achieve production speeds that rival traditional methods while maintaining the flexibility of digital design.

Top 4 Industry Trends:

  • Multi-Material Printing: The ability to print functional parts with varying hardness, conductivity, and color in a single build.
  • Nano-Scale Precision: Micro-3D printing for electronics and medical micro-robotics is gaining massive traction.
  • Cloud-Connected Factories: 3D printer exporters are now offering IoT-enabled machines that allow remote monitoring and global print-farm management.
  • Standardization: The establishment of ISO/ASTM standards for additive manufacturing ensures that 3D-printed parts meet safety requirements for critical industries.
